Exclusive! Nitesh Tiwari talks about his journey in KBC, the nightmare of a writer, and the challenges he faces

Nitesh speaks about his journey in KBC.

MUMBAI: Kaun Banega Crorepati is one of the most loved and successful reality shows on television.

The show has been running for more than two decades and is always in the top five shows when it comes to TRP ratings.

Nitesh is one of the most successful and talented directors and writers that we have in Bollywood. He has made many successful movies like Dangal, Bareilly Ki Barfi, and Chhichhore.

The director has been associated with the popular reality show KBC since it aired on television. He has been conceptualizing the campaign ads for KBC.

Recently, at a press conference, the director unveiled the first campaign promo and also spoke about his association with KBC and the challenges he has faced in these 11 years.

( ALSO READ : Nitesh Tiwari: Never thought that cooking could also give me joy )

Nitesh said that he has been working with KBC for 11 years, and the show doesn’t need any introduction. He had joined the show when his wife was the head of the creative team and that’s when they began the campaign of KBC. Back then, they had released three commercials, which became a massive hit among the audiences and set a benchmark for the show. 

He further said that the biggest challenge is that every year, he needs to come with a campaign that’s better than the previous one.

It is a writer's nightmare when his entire team comes together and writes for the KBC campion ad. The motto is always to come up with something exciting that will be loved by the audiences.
